Quadbarrel Looking forward this race again. Great course round the grounds of Chatelherault. No chance of a pb on an undulating course which, if it's the same as last year, has a long descent by steps, and steep climb towards the finish. Also got my 2 eldest kids (6 and 7) in the 1k race which should be great fun. **** Update 03/02. Unofficial time. Great race. Blustery conditions but enjoyable all the same.
